Output 312c78749cc5f63c10e58cc0772d3e0c4a1cbe6cad859302b6e6c1aebcf4739b:0

value
573800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141ea98b5a274e16adb7e539ec7e173d8c068bb0 OP_EQUAL
address
33XQAqGpgpEXMgbLwzTPoFEEmGeBVP3sc5
transaction
312c78749cc5f63c10e58cc0772d3e0c4a1cbe6cad859302b6e6c1aebcf4739b
spent
true